About P. Beauchamp

P. Beauchamp is a scholar working on Astronomy and Astrophysics, Aerospace Engineering, Surgery, Oceanography and Atomic and Molecular Physics, and Optics, having authored 49 papers that have together received 552 indexed citations. Recurring topics across this work include Astro and Planetary Science (28 papers), Planetary Science and Exploration (20 papers), Space Exploration and Technology (8 papers), Spacecraft Design and Technology (7 papers), Spacecraft and Cryogenic Technologies (5 papers), Spacecraft Dynamics and Control (4 papers), Space Science and Extraterrestrial Life (3 papers) and Stellar, planetary, and galactic studies (3 papers). The work is most often cited by research in Astronomy and Astrophysics (311 citations), Aerospace Engineering (155 citations), Atmospheric Science (78 citations), Spectroscopy (66 citations) and Environmental Chemistry (29 citations). P. Beauchamp has collaborated with scholars based in United States, France and Netherlands. Frequent co-authors include Robert Hodyss, Morgan L. Cable, Mark A. Smith, Sarah M. Hörst, Peter A. Willis, J. A. Cutts, Mathieu Choukroun, Marco B. Quadrelli, MiMi Aung and Joseph E. Riedel. Their work appears in journals such as Geophysical Research Letters, Space Science Reviews, The Journal of Physical Chemistry A, Journal of Guidance Control and Dynamics and Chemical Reviews.
